DESCRIPTION:
Michael plays fingerstyle nylon and steel string instrumental guitar. He has performed events for Chevrolet, Ping Golf Corp, Oscar Meyer, Wells Fargo et al. Michael has crafted his performances to specialise in weddings and special events. He has performed his own concerts and opened for Herbie Hancock, Tom Scott and Scott Cossu as well. Michael's been performing weddings/events for the last 33 years and since 1988 in Washington and Oregon from Skamania to Cannon Beach, Seattle to Eugene. His genre is Classical, Celtic, Spanish/Flamenco, music of the 20's to the 50's, Bossa Nova, traditional Latin, Jazz Standards, 60's and 70's to the present, Soft Rock, Blues, original from his recordings. He has received world wide airplay from the US, Canada, Britain to Japan. Local radio station in Portland, Or. KMHD FM 89.1 has aired his music since 1988 and KINK FM 102 radio. since 1991. His music is featured on "KINK Lights Out 9 and 10". Proceeds from sales go to the Oregon Food Bank. Michael won an American Eagle Award from the CMAA in 1996 for "Songwriter of the Year". Michael's recording "Come back to Sorrento" from his release "Amor" is used in a sitcom in Canada called "Alice, I Think". He released a Christmas CD called "Acoustic Christmas" just last November 2006. And from that release the American Greetings Corporation is using his recording of John Lennon's "Happy Xmas (War is Over)" in a John Lennon Christmas ornament coming out in 2008. All of his 55 recorded songs can be found on popular download sites: itunes, SMS.ac, Musicforte, etc. Currently he's recording songs he composed and performed at weddings.
